WaldorfEssentials.com Waldorf Essentials exists to support families who are called to an intentional, more meaningful approach to education — one that honors the whole child: head, heart, and hands. Waldorf Essentials offers intentionally crafted curriculum, training, and family resources rooted in Rudolf Steiner’s developmental insights. Our work bridges the beauty and depth of Waldorf education with the practical realities of modern family life, making it accessible, flexible, and sustainable for homeschooling families around the world.
